1. The Hydro Majestic Hotel

Hydro Majestic Restaurant

   – Location: Medlow Bath

   – Cuisine: Fine Dining

   – Highlights: Nestled within the iconic Hydro Majestic Hotel, this restaurant is a pinnacle of fine dining experiences. The ambience is as exceptional as the cuisine, with panoramic views of the Blue Mountains creating a mesmerizing backdrop. Immerse yourself in a culinary journey featuring dishes crafted from the finest seasonal, locally sourced ingredients. The fusion of elegant decor, impeccable service, and the surrounding natural beauty makes every dining moment here an unforgettable celebration of taste and aesthetics.

2. Pins on Lurline

   – Location: Katoomba

   – Cuisine: Contemporary Australian with a European twist

   – Highlights: Pins on Lurline stands out as a charming restaurant with a historic heritage-listed setting, adding character to the dining experience. The diverse menu is a culinary journey that marries modern Australian cuisine with European flavours, promising a symphony of tastes. Perfect for special occasions, the ambience complements the dishes, creating an atmosphere where every bite is enhanced by the rich history and contemporary flair.

4. Darley’s Restaurant

Darleys Restaurant

 – Location: Katoomba

   – Cuisine: Fine Dining

   – Highlights: Located within the historic Lilianfels Blue Mountains Resort & Spa, Darley’s Restaurant is a beacon of culinary excellence. Renowned for its exquisite degustation menu, the restaurant boasts an elegant ambience that transports diners to a bygone era of sophistication. Each dish is a masterpiece, blending flavours seamlessly and elevating the dining experience to new heights. For those seeking a truly special and refined gastronomic adventure, Darley’s is an absolute must-visit.

5. Echoes Restaurant & Bar

   – Location: Katoomba

   – Cuisine: Modern Australian

   – Highlights: With breathtaking views of the Jamison Valley, Echoes Restaurant & Bar is more than a dining destination; it’s a visual feast for the senses. The menu, inspired by modern Australian cuisine, showcases a perfect balance of creativity and culinary expertise. The bar, known for its creative cocktails, complements the overall experience, making it a perfect place to unwind after a day of exploring the Blue Mountains. Every visit to Echoes is a journey where gastronomy and panoramic landscapes unite in perfect harmony.
